#227c38 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#227c38 is composed of 13.3% red, 48.6%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 72.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 54.8% yellow and 51.4% black. It has a hue angle of 134.7 degrees, a saturation of 57% and a lightness of 31%. #227c38 color hex could be obtained by blending #44f870 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

● #227c38 color description : Dark lime green.
#227c38 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#227c38 has RGB values of R:34, G:124,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0.73, M:0, Y:0.55,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 2260024.

Shades and Tints of #227c38
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f0fbf3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#227c38
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4d514e is the less saturated color, while #049a28 is the most saturated one.
